****SOLUTION***

I had the same isssue (started in 8/2020) and thus far only is happening on one stick up cam…annoying that Ring is blind to the issue. A reset is all it needs:

  1. Take off the battery cap.

  2. You’ll see an orange button - hold for X-seconds (not sure, try 10) - this will remove the camera.

  3. Go back to the Ring app - tap the 3 vertical lines in the upper left.

  4. Tap “Set up a Device”

  5. Follow the screens. You’re essentially following the same steps you did when you first bought the camera.

…this worked for me…good luck.

yes my girlfriends son just informed me that this annoying beep came back today. an I found out there was a firmware update last night.

it appears when ring does these firmware updates the automatic update does not complete upload so it shows there are problems which in return sends out this annoying beep.

so if you re-install the camera my thoght it the firmware they were trying to install will then successfully install.
